Miami Dolphins' Struggles Against the Seahawks

In a disappointing Week 3 matchup, the Miami Dolphins faced the Seattle Seahawks and suffered a significant 24-3 defeat. The situation at quarterback for Miami has intensified as Skyler Thompson was knocked out of the game due to a chest injury, leaving the team scrambling for solutions.

Thompson's Injury and Impact on the Game

Thompson, who stepped in as the starter with Tua Tagovailoa on injured reserve for concussion recovery, took a series of punishing hits from the Seahawks’ defense. Despite Miami's hopes for a rally, Thompson’s exit early in the second half after being hit multiple times hampered their chances of scoring. He sustained injuries after being blindsided by Seahawks linebacker Derick Hall before halftime and took another heavy blow from Tyrel Dodson on a critical third down early in the second half.

A Glimmer of Hope Before Exit

The final blow came during a drive where Thompson had seemed to find a rhythm, completing a 17-yard pass to Tyreek Hill. Unfortunately, after a short pass to De'Von Achane, Thompson was struck in the midsection, forcing him to leave the game. Despite walking to the locker room unaided, the Dolphins later confirmed he would not return for the game, though initial reports suggested the injury wasn't as severe as first anticipated.

Quarterback Statistics

Thompson finished the game with solid statistics, throwing for 107 yards on 13 of 19 passing attempts, while his replacement, Tim Boyle, managed to gain 79 yards completing 7 of 13 passes.

Potential Next Moves for the Dolphins

Adding to the intrigue, the Dolphins had signed Tyler Huntley from the Baltimore Ravens’ practice squad just prior to the game. Boyle’s presence on the field was expected as he had some familiarity with the offensive scheme. Huntley, labeled as the emergency quarterback for the game, may take the reigns if Thompson is unable to recover quickly. As the former Pro Bowler, Huntley could potentially provide a different dynamic that the Dolphins desperately need moving forward.

Tua Tagovailoa's Status

Tua Tagovailoa is expected to be sidelined for at least three more games while he works through the concussion protocol. His prolonged absence means the Dolphins may need to rely heavily on their backup options in the coming weeks.
